Best New Middletown Public Schools (2026-27)

For the 2026-27 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 858 students in New Middletown, OH (there are 1 private school, serving 97 private students). 90% of all K-12 students in New Middletown, OH are educated in public schools (compared to the OH state average of 88%).
The top-ranked public schools in New Middletown, OH are Springfield Elementary School, Springfield Intermediate Middle School and Springfield High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
New Middletown, OH public schools have an average math proficiency score of 78% (versus the Ohio public school average of 55%), and reading proficiency score of 79% (versus the 60% statewide average). Schools in New Middletown have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Ohio public schools.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Ohio public school average of 35% (majority Black).
